[QUOTE="Minigiant, post: 9241212, member: 63508"] The question with Blind Fighting is what is giving you bllndsight. It's not hearing because you don't lose it because of deafness. Not it's an extraordinary sense to be able to sense nearby foes and attack them. That's +1 to melee weapon attack rolls. [B]Blind Fighting[/B] You have blindsight with a range of 10 feet. Within that range, you can effectively see anything that isn't behind total cover, even if you're blinded or in darkness. Moreover, you can see an invisible creature within that range, unless the creature successfully hides from you [B]and you gain a +1 bonus to attack rolls you make with melee weapons within 5 feet of you[/B]. [B]Thrown Weapon Fighting[/B] You can draw a weapon that has the thrown property as part of the attack you make with the weapon. In addition, when you hit with a ranged attack using a thrown weapon, you gain a bonus to the damage roll [B]equal to your proficiency modifier. Superior Technique [/B] You learn one maneuver of your choice from among those available to the Battle Master archetype. If a maneuver you use requires your target to make a saving throw to resist the maneuver's effects, the saving throw DC equals 8 + your proficiency bonus + your Strength or Dexterity modifier (your choice.) You gain [B]two[/B] superiority die, which [B]are[/B] d6s (this die is added to any superiority dice you have from another source). This die is used to fuel your maneuvers. A superiority die is expended when you use it. You regain your expended superiority dice when you finish a short or long rest. [/QUOTE]
